Distance From San Vicente Airport to Tokyo Haneda International Airport

The distance from San Vicente Airport () to Tokyo Haneda International Airport (HND) is 6847 miles or 11019 kilometers or 5946 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Coahuayana ( Mexico ) to Tokyo ( Japan )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Coahuayana and Tokyo takes around 15 hours 44 minutes.
Estimated flight time from San Vicente Airport, Coahuayana, Mexico to Tokyo Haneda International Airport, Tokyo, Japan is 15 hours 44 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. In addition, it does not cover the person identity check, ticket check-in and baggage collection times at the airport.

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
